Excerpt from The Eastern Question: Speeches Delivered in the House of Lords by William Frederick, Lord Stratheden and Campbell, 1871-1891

HE present collection of the speeches of the late Lord Stratheden and Campbell upon the Eastern Question is the result of a suggestion made by the late Lord Ampthill. In the course of several visits to Berlin between 1874 and 1878 (the period beginning with the Insurrection in the Herzegovina and ending with the Treaty of Berlin), Lord Stratheden had many opportunities of submitting to Lord Ampthill the opinions he had formed upon British policy in the East, enforced in the speeches contained in this volume. Lord Ampthill - whose mastery of diplomacy and European policy was universally admitted - was so impressed with the sound views and extensive knowledge displayed in Lord Stratheden's speeches, that he urged him to publish them in a collected form.

With such a witness to their value, the Editors, in carrying out the testamentary duty imposed upon them by the late Lord Stratheden, feel that it would be quite out of place for them to add any remarks of their own upon the importance of the speeches which they now place before the public.
